Alesis Introduces GuitarFX Processor July 23, 2002
Alesis has introduced its new GuitarFX Processor, a floor multi-effects unit which puts powerful effects processing technology beneath the feet of guitarists worldwide. GuitarFX is a full-featured DSP toolbox designed to give guitarists incredible-sounding distortion, amplifier modeling, modulation effects, delays and reverbs--all in a compact, easy-to-use pedalboard for stage and studio applications.
GuitarFX's extremely intuitive user interface delivers Alesis' DSP technology in the form of 100 Preset/User programs, taking guitarists from high-gain distortion mayhem to subtle overdriven sounds, modulation effects, lush reverb and more. Each of GuitarFX's 28-bit effects and amplifier models have been carefully chosen from Alesis' extensive DSP arsenal, and can be completely customized via simple front panel controls.
Large Increment/Decrement pedals and an expression pedal input make GuitarFX perfectly suited for live use, while a built-in auto-chromatic tuner provides for fast tuning on stage; battery or 9VDC operation means GuitarFX is ready to travel. GuitarFX connections include Guitar input, Stereo Line/Headphone output, and Expression Pedal input.
